How CPR Works: The Basic Steps You’ll Master
CPR is built on a simple foundation called the “chain of survival.” Here’s what you’ll learn to do:
Step 1: Check Responsiveness and Call 911
Your first job is to confirm the person is unresponsive and immediately call emergency services. Don’t wait. Don’t assume someone else will do it. Call 911 right now.
Step 2: Position the Person
Place the person on their back on a firm, flat surface. Clear the airway and prepare for the next step.
Step 3: Hand Placement and Compressions
Place the heel of one hand on the center of the chest, place your other hand on top, and push hard and fast. You’ll perform chest compressions at a rate of 100-120 compressions per minute. This keeps blood flowing to the brain and vital organs.
Step 4: Rescue Breaths (if trained)
After 30 compressions, provide two rescue breaths if you’re trained in this technique. If not, hands-only CPR (compressions alone) is also highly effective, especially for adults.
Step 5: Continue Until Help Arrives
Keep going. Don’t stop. Don’t second-guess yourself. The professionals will take over when they arrive.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Our instructors see the same fears come up repeatedly, and we want to address them head-on:
- Fear of doing it wrong: The only truly wrong response is doing nothing. CPR that isn’t perfect is infinitely better than no CPR at all.
- Stopping too soon: Don’t give up after a minute or two. Continue compressions until emergency responders arrive or the person shows clear signs of life.
- Hesitation due to worry about “breaking ribs”: Yes, aggressive compressions can sometimes cause rib fractures. But here’s the reality: a broken rib heals; a stopped heart doesn’t.
